Output d158342320de741b90e8a85a7ea218425905c35e3f8a29227c29d68d12a20b16:1

value
1969944076
script pubkey
OP_0 OP_PUSHBYTES_20 456d2dec770d75fd7db779af1a17d7c7b20bdbee
address
tb1qg4kjmmrhp46l6ldh0xh3597hc7eqhklwhvg98f
transaction
d158342320de741b90e8a85a7ea218425905c35e3f8a29227c29d68d12a20b16
spent
true